Portola shut down near Fred Waring after power pole catches on fire

Portola Avenue was shut down near Fred Waring Drive after a power pole caught on fire Monday evening.

Southern California Edison said all service should be restored by 8:00 a.m. Tuesday.

The fire was reported at around 7:44 p.m., according to Cal Fire. Firefighters were able to quickly contain the fire. Crews at the scene told KESQ & CBS Local 2 the fire damaged two outbuildings and has left four houses without power. Those homes will be without fire for 12 to 24 hours.

Crews added that Portola Dr. was shut down between El Cortez Way and Catalina Way. There were also road blocks at Fred Waring Dr. and Vianza Way. Authorities were only allowing residents of homes in the area pass the closure.

The cause of the fire remains under investigation. Firefighters were expected to remain on scene for several hours.
